The Origins of the Surname 'Bron'

The surname 'Bron' is of Dutch origin and is derived from the Dutch word 'brun', which means brown. It is believed that the name may have originally been a nickname for someone with brown hair or eyes. Surnames often originated as descriptive identifiers to distinguish between individuals in a community, and 'Bron' may have been one such identifier.

Another theory suggests that 'Bron' could have been a locational surname, derived from a place named Bron in the Netherlands. Locational surnames were often given to individuals based on their place of residence or birth, and Bron could have been the ancestral home of the first bearers of the name.

Prevalence of the Surname 'Bron' Worldwide

The surname 'Bron' has a global presence, with significant numbers of individuals bearing the name in multiple countries. According to data gathered from various sources, the incidence of the surname 'Bron' is highest in the Philippines, with 4139 individuals carrying the name. This suggests a strong presence of individuals with Filipino heritage who bear the surname 'Bron'.

The Netherlands also has a notable number of individuals with the surname 'Bron, with 2827 incidences recorded. This is not surprising, considering the Dutch origin of the name and its historical significance in the country. France, Switzerland, and Cambodia are among the other countries where the surname 'Bron' is relatively common, with varying numbers of individuals carrying the name.

In the United States, the surname 'Bron' is less common compared to other countries, with 415 incidences reported. However, the name still maintains a presence in American society, reflecting the diverse origins of the country's population. Other countries with significant numbers of individuals bearing the surname 'Bron' include South Africa, Russia, Germany, Argentina, Canada, and Australia, among others.
